For the 2025-26 school year, there are 2 public schools serving 779 students in Stanley 2 School District. This district's average testing ranking is 3/10, which is in the bottom 50% of public schools in North Dakota.
Public Schools in Stanley 2 School District have an average math proficiency score of 29% (versus the North Dakota public school average of 39%), and reading proficiency score of 40% (versus the 44% statewide average).
Minority enrollment is 22%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is less than the North Dakota public school average of 29% (majority American Indian and Hispanic).

District Revenue and Spending

The revenue/student of $17,406 in this school district is less than the state median of $17,628. The school district revenue/student has declined by 8% over four school years.
The school district's spending/student of $16,255 is less than the state median of $17,630. The school district spending/student has declined by 8% over four school years.
